Latest Patents
Among his latest patents are the "Panel Attachment Fixture" and the "Ship Operation Panel Structure." The Panel Attachment Fixture represents a significant technological advancement, allowing for a single or a pair of electrical components to be efficiently arranged on an attachment-receiving panel. This fixture features a flange section with predetermined electric components, such as switches, mounted on its front surface. It can be securely attached to an attachment-receiving panel through a specially designed body section.
The body section includes fitting parts for both independent and parallel attachment states, enabling the attachment of one or two fixture bodies in a manner that maintains ease of installation and functionality.
